This is a collection of 14 essays on a variety of occult-themed topics, covering the full spectrum of classic esoterica and related subjects, which include hermeticism, alchemy, magic, the Kabbalah, ancient wisdom and philosophy, the Tarot, Rosicrucianism, Freemasonry, Theosophy, and spiritualism, by some of the most notable and prominent names in the history of those subjects. Compiled specifically with the student in mind.

The contents include:

  1. “The Three Fold Division of Mysticism” by Arthur Edward Waite
  2. "Occult Lore of the Crossroads" by W. N. Neill
  3. "An Analysis of the Tarot Cards" by Manly P. Hall
  4. “Rosicrucians, Occultism and Kabbalah” by Helena P. Blavatsky
  5. “The Mirror of Alchemy” by Roger Bacon
  6. “On the Higher Aspects of Theosophic Studies” by Mohini M. Chatterji
  7. “The Kabbalistic Conclusions of Pico della Mindola” by Arthur Edward Waite
  8. “Divine Magic” by Jessie Horne
  9. “Jacob Boehme and the Secret Doctrine” by William Q. Judge
  10. “Concerning Madame Blavatsky” by G. R. S. Mead
  11. “The Sprig of Acacia” by Albert G. Mackey
  12. “Conversations on Occultism” by William Q. Judge and Helena P. Blavatsky
  13. “Discovering the Names of Spirits” by Heinrich Cornelius Agrippa
  14. “Hermetic Philosophy” by P. W. Bullock
